hello ive just come back from a view of a rover p5b which is really on the ball,However"owning rv8s for 30 years "this one has a strange knock that hides behind the firing so to speak under load.sounds deep like big ends,but not the familiar patern...So has left me to think crank mains?....but as ive never heard a v8 with main problems,im stuck to guess what it is.
Rev the nuts out of it in nautraul as its whisper quiet,only under load or really cold..,has great oil pressure hot or cold..
any ideas?

Piston slap? worn out engine mount allowing contact with the side of the engine bay causing a rattle. Flexplate/Flywheel comming loose?
Mains can go, on an engine as low tune as the rover you can have the crank fall in half at the centre main and only get a rattle as you go from load to over run otherwise no symptoms. Best advice I can think of is to drop the sump and have a look.
While I'm thinking of possable causes, the damper may have perrished rubber and be moving more than it should under load, fine off load and reved.

You have checked the exhaust manifold and system for leaks? just when they are from close to the engine they can sound very "metallic", normally miss identified as tappet noise though.
